Description

Family Owned Eaton Turner Jewelry, Montana's Longest Standing Jewelry Store Has Been Offering Full Service Since 1885. Don And Corey Johnson, Father And Son, Are Award Winning Goldsmith-designers Creating Custom Jewelry On Site. Both Don And Corey Are Graduate Gemologists From GIA (Gemological Institute Of America). With The Use Of CAD-CAM Designing And 3-D Wax Milling For Precision, We Serve Another Dimension To The Custom Process. Custom Jewelry Is Also Created By Traditional Techniques, Including Hand Carving Wax In Preparation For Casting, And Hand Fabrication Directly From Metal. Laser Welding Technology Gives Us The Ability To Build And Repair Jewelry Effectively, Including Difficult Repairs. Eyeglasses Are Professionally Repaired With Our Laser Welder. Free Cleaning And Checking Of Your Jewelry Is Always Provided. We Inventory Exceptional Fine Diamonds At Competitive Prices, Wedding Sets, Yogo And Montana Sapphires, Colored Stones, Gold, Platinum, Palladium, And Silver Jewelry.
